The Milwaukee Brewers made MLB history Monday night, surviving a wild 15-14 win over the Athletics at Las Vegas Ballpark despite allowing seven home runs. The first-place Brewers improved to 41-23 by outlasting an Athletics offense that kept answering across 12 innings. The game produced 29 runs, 34 hits, 11 home runs, and 444 pitches […]

The Athletics are currently playing their home games in Sacramento, California. Still, Sacramento will lose its temporary MLB team in the 2028 season, as the Athletics will be moving to Las Vegas, Nevada. As part of the preparation for the move to Vegas, the Athletics are playing six games in Vegas at Las Vegas Ball […]

The Milwaukee Brewers acquired right-handed reliever Joel Kuhnel from the Athletics for cash considerations, the same day Brian Fitzpatrick became their eighth pitcher on the injured list.
Fitzpatrick hurt his left elbow after throwing one warmup pitch in the seventh inning Friday against Colorado and was placed on the 15-day IL with a UCL strain, with manager Pat Murphy acknowledging the organization needs another medical opinion to determine whether Tommy John surgery is required.
